Find the value of sin L rounded to the nearest hundredth, if necessary. The letters are L, M, and N while the numbers are 10, 24, and 26.

Sine = (opposite side)/(hypotenuse). The triangle 10–24–26 is right (26 is the hypotenuse).
So sin(L) = (side opposite L)/26. That gives:
- If the side opposite L is 10: sin L = 10/26 = 5/13 ≈ 0.38.
- If the side opposite L is 24: sin L = 24/26 = 12/13 ≈ 0.92.
- If the side opposite L is 26 (i.e. L is the right angle): sin L = 1.00.
